    Susan M. "Sue" Perrotto is an American animator, screenwriter, director, producer, and storyboard artist. She worked on animated shows, like Codename Kids Next Door and Camp Lazlo.

    For Disney, she served as a storyboard artist, director, and producer for the Disney Channel animated series The Replacements, Phineas and Ferb, and Miles from Tomorrowland (in which she also voiced the Gabagah). She also worked on a few Winnie the Pooh productions. In addition, she is a supervising director on the Disney Junior series Mira, Royal Detective.

  6. Sue Perrotto is a 1990 graduate of UGFTV and its Animation Program. She is a four-time Emmy Nominee for her work as a director on Phineas & Ferb series and The Grim Adventures of Billy & Mandy. She has worked in every area of the animation industry, including storyboarding, layout, animation, timing supervisor, voice talent and director.
